Definitions and meanings of "Eschew"

What do we mean by eschew?

To avoid using, accepting, participating in, or partaking of: synonym: evade. transitive verb

To refrain from (doing something). transitive verb

Unwilling; disinclined.

To refuse to use or participate in; stand aloof from; shun; avoid.

To escape from; evade.

To shun; to avoid, as something wrong, or from a feeling of distaste; to keep one's self clear of. transitive verb

To escape from; to avoid. transitive verb

To avoid; to shun, to shy away from. verb

Avoid and stay away from deliberately; stay clear of verb

To avoid; to shun, to shy away from.
